What does "qualified" mean in your model?
Three-point standard, and all three must be met. Verified need — a real facility with a cleaning contract up for bid, or a provider they’ve actually named a problem with, not idle price curiosity. Signing authority — a facility manager, operations director, or procurement lead who controls the contract, not a receptionist or tenant. Active contract timeline — a live bid or renewal with a date attached. Anything short of all three doesn’t make your calendar. Most agencies count any form-fill with a pulse as a “lead.” We don’t.

What if the building only wants a one-off clean?
We screen for it before you ever dial. A contact shopping for a single one-off clean isn’t a janitorial meeting — it’s a disqualification. We qualify on facility type, square footage, and whether a recurring contract is actually up for bid, so your team only talks to buildings that can sign a real account — not one-off work dressed up as a lead.

Can you target by facility type, square footage, or current provider?
Yes, and targeting goes deeper than industry alone. We layer facility type, square footage, single-site versus multi-site, current cleaning provider, contract renewal timing, geography, and the signals that mean a bid is coming up. The output is a tight facility list that fits your service model — not a generic business pull from a list vendor. Sloppy targeting is the single biggest reason outbound campaigns underperform.
